Leather Sewing Machine Market Overview
![A closeup on hands and the machine](http://img.baba-blog.com/2024/06/A-closeup-on-hands-and-the-machine.png?x-oss-process=style%2Flarge)
The global leather sewing machine market has experienced significant growth in recent years, driven by the increasing demand for high-quality leather goods. As of 2024, the market size reached approximately USD 2.8 billion and is projected to grow at a CAGR of 5.1% through 2030, reaching USD 3.8 billion by the end of the forecast period. This growth is attributed to the rising popularity of leather products in various industries, including fashion, automotive, and furniture.
The demand for leather sewing machines is particularly strong in regions such as North America, Europe, and Asia-Pacific. North America and Europe are key markets due to their established leather industries and high consumer spending on luxury goods. In contrast, the Asia-Pacific region is witnessing rapid growth due to its robust manufacturing capabilities and increasing disposable incomes. China, India, and Japan are notable contributors to the market’s expansion in this region.
The market is segmented based on machine type, including manual, semi-automatic, and fully automatic leather sewing machines. Fully automatic machines are gaining traction due to their efficiency and ability to handle complex stitching tasks. The industrial sector dominates the application segment, driven by the need for high precision and productivity in mass production environments.

Key Factors When Selecting a Leather Sewing Machine
![Macchina da cucire a braccio lungo](http://img.baba-blog.com/2024/06/Long-arm-sewing-machine.png?x-oss-process=style%2Flarge)
When selecting a leather sewing machine, consider various factors to ensure the machine meets required standards and performance criteria. These factors include types and styles, performance and functionality, technical specifications, build quality and materials, and price range.
Tipi e stili
Leather sewing machines come in different types and styles, each designed for specific applications. The most common types include flatbed, cylinder arm, and post bed machines. Flatbed machines are similar to regular sewing machines but are more robust and designed to handle thicker materials like leather. They are typically used for straight seams on flat pieces of leather, making them ideal for items like wallets and belts. Cylinder arm machines feature a cylindrical bed, allowing them to sew cylindrical or tubular items like bags and shoes. The cylinder arm’s design offers greater versatility and accessibility, making it easier to handle complex projects. Post bed machines have a raised bed, or post, that allows for sewing in hard-to-reach areas. They are particularly useful for attaching labels, emblems, and other small details on leather products.
Prestazioni e funzionalità
The performance and functionality of a leather sewing machine are critical factors. A key performance metric is the machine’s stitch speed, often measured in stitches per minute (SPM). High-speed machines can significantly increase productivity, especially in industrial settings. Another important aspect is the machine’s stitch length and width adjustability. This feature allows for greater flexibility in creating different stitch patterns and designs, essential for customizing leather products. Additionally, the machine’s ability to handle different thread sizes and types is crucial. Leather sewing often requires thicker, more durable threads, so the machine must accommodate these without compromising stitch quality.
Specifiche tecniche
Technical specifications are vital when selecting a leather sewing machine. One of the most important specifications is the machine’s needle system. Leather requires specialized needles, such as wedge or chisel point needles, to penetrate the material without damaging it. The machine’s motor power is another critical specification. Leather sewing machines typically have more powerful motors than standard sewing machines to handle the thicker, tougher material. Motor power is usually measured in horsepower (HP), with higher HP indicating a more powerful machine. The machine’s feed mechanism is also essential. Compound feed, walking foot, and needle feed mechanisms are commonly used in leather sewing machines to ensure consistent and even feeding of the material. This helps prevent issues like skipped stitches and uneven seams.
Qualità costruttiva e materiali
The build quality and materials used in a leather sewing machine directly impact its durability and longevity. Machines made from high-quality materials like cast iron or heavy-duty steel are more robust and can withstand the rigors of sewing thick leather. The quality of the machine’s internal components, such as gears and bearings, also plays a significant role in its overall performance and lifespan. High-quality components reduce the likelihood of breakdowns and ensure smooth, reliable operation. Additionally, the machine’s finish and protective coatings are important considerations. Machines with corrosion-resistant coatings or finishes are better suited for long-term use, especially in environments where they may be exposed to moisture or other corrosive elements.
Fascia di prezzo e budget
Price range and budget are always important considerations when selecting a leather sewing machine. Industrial-grade machines, designed for high-volume production, are typically more expensive than domestic models. However, they offer greater durability, power, and functionality. Entry-level machines for hobbyists or small-scale operations can be more affordable but may lack some advanced features found in higher-end models. It’s essential to balance cost with the required features and performance to ensure the best value for money. When considering the price, it’s also important to factor in the cost of accessories and maintenance. Some machines may require specialized attachments or periodic servicing, which can add to the overall cost of ownership.
Latest Technology Features in Leather Sewing Machines
![sewing machine's needle and thread stitching leather material on red color seat cover](http://img.baba-blog.com/2024/06/sewing-machines-needle-and-thread-stitching-leather-material-on-red-color-seat-cover.png?x-oss-process=style%2Flarge)
The leather sewing machine industry has seen significant advancements in technology, enhancing functionality and efficiency. Modern machines often come equipped with features like automatic thread trimming, digital stitch control, and advanced feed mechanisms. Automatic thread trimming is a valuable feature that saves time and reduces manual intervention. This function automatically trims the thread at the end of each seam, ensuring clean and professional finishes. Digital stitch control allows for precise adjustments to stitch length, width, and tension. This feature is particularly useful for intricate designs and ensures consistent stitch quality across different projects. Advanced feed mechanisms, such as compound feed or walking foot systems, provide better material handling and reduce the risk of skipped stitches and uneven seams. These mechanisms ensure smooth and consistent feeding of the leather, even for thick and multi-layered materials.

Conformità normativa e standard di sicurezza
![Macchina da cucire per primo piano della pelle](http://img.baba-blog.com/2024/06/Sewing-machine-for-leather-closeup-2.jpg?x-oss-process=style%2Ffull)
Regulatory compliance and safety standards are essential considerations when selecting a leather sewing machine. Machines should meet industry standards and certifications to ensure safe and reliable operation. Common safety standards include CE (Conformité Européene) marking, which indicates compliance with European safety, health, and environmental protection requirements. Machines with CE marking have undergone rigorous testing to ensure they meet these standards. Other certifications, such as UL (Underwriters Laboratories) or CSA (Canadian Standards Association), indicate that the machine has been tested and certified for safety and performance by recognized organizations. It’s also important to consider the machine’s safety features, such as needle guards, emergency stop buttons, and automatic shut-off mechanisms. These features help protect operators from potential hazards and reduce the risk of accidents.
